WBO lightweight champion Terry Flanagan (33-0, 13 KOs) defeated mandatory challenger Petr Petrov (38-5-2, 19 KOs) by unanimous decision on Saturday night at the Manchester Arena.
The Manchester man outboxed Petrov in most of the rounds and won by scores of 116-112, 120-108 and 118-110.
Flanagan boxed well behind his jab with good movement in the first round but Petrov landed some hard shots in the second.
